What makes A2 so good?
A2 is a Tank-type character but functions as the main DPS of the NieR team. She deals high damage and is extremely durable.
All of the NieR characters can sprint at any time continuously for no cost, just like in NieR: Automata
A2 also has a glide that lasts a few seconds (activated by holding down the dodge button) which pulls groups of enemies in behind her, charging her Shield gauge at the same time
An Amazing Blue Orb Skill
Her Blue Orb skill is a ranged attack that pulls enemies into its center from quite far away
A2 automatically uses a 3-Ping version of this attack upon switch-in
At SSS-Rank, her Blue Orb not only sucks enemies in, it also stuns them for a few seconds
Her Signature Move lets her enter Berserk Mode
Berserk Mode is similar to Kamui: Tenebrion's Dark Form in that it lasts even when A2 switches with another character
This grants her Super Armor, which prevents her from being stunned
Berserk Mode consumes her Shield, but the Shield can be restored either through her glide or through the use of 3-Ping attacks
Because it's easy to maintain her Shield, A2 can endure a lot of damage
In Berserk Mode, each 3-Ping also causes POD to fire off missiles which inflict 20% Physical DEF down on enemies; with the full NieR team, this effect is doubled to 40%, even at S-Rank
At SSS-Rank, the base Physical DEF down inflicted by POD is 40%, and with the full NieR team, this is doubled to 80%
The last 20% Physical DEF down needed to achieve a full 100% can be gained from Catherine
At SS-Rank, POD will shoot missiles every 4 seconds as long as her Berserk Mode is active, even when A2 is off-field, as long as she went into Berserk Mode before you swap characters (Note: Berserk Mode can turn off even when she is off-field once her shield gauge is empty, so it is best to swap her out when the gauge is high)
This means that the Physical DEF down caused by POD will persist infinitely while you are using 2B or 9S
In other words, at SSS-Rank, you can achieve 100% uptime on a 100% Physical DEF down debuff

Why is 9S significant?
9S does not need to generate Orbs by attacking; he gets them passively over time
Each time 9S activates his Core Passive, he reduces his own next swap cooldown by 1 second, up to a total of 4 seconds
His Signature Weapon also impacts this by additionally reducing 2B's and A2's next swap cooldown by 1 second, with no upper limit
His SS-Rank passive allows his Blue Orb skill and QTE to give a Physical DMG increase of 10% for 8 seconds to 2B and A2
SSS-Rank further increases this to 20% for 12 seconds, as well as giving him even faster Signal Orb generation

What kind of Tickets are used to pull NieR characters via gacha?
The NieR characters require special NieR Tickets; this means that Event Construct R&D Tickets will NOT work on NieR banners, but BC can still be converted into these special NieR Tickets.
What kind of Tickets are used to pull NieR weapons via gacha?
The NieR weapons require special NieR Tickets; this means that Target Weapon R&D Tickets will NOT work on NieR banners, but BC can still be converted into these special NieR Tickets.
Like all other 6★ weapons, the targeted NieR weapon has an 80% chance of being the weapon you pity
However, the other two possible 6★ weapons on each NieR weapon banner belong to the other two NieR characters, meaning you are guaranteed a 6★ NieR weapon at pity, even if it is not your targeted one
Why does it cost less BC to pull for NieR characters than other characters?
Although each NieR character still has a pity of 60 pulls and technically costs the usual 15,000 BC when converting them directly, each 10-pull spent on a NieR banner will be rewarded with a bonus of 750 special NieR Tickets. If you have to go to pity for a character, this will mean you save 4,500 BC/NieR Tickets and technically only spend 10,500 BC/NieR Tickets.
This also occurs during the re-run, and the pity count carries over from Untold Naraka as well.
Note: This bonus does NOT apply to NieR weapons.

How does the NieR team compare with the other Physical team?
Ultimately, it is better not to compare them at all.
The Physical team featuring Lucia: Crimson Abyss and Rosetta: Rigor has extremely high burst damage. They do not have the consistent, non-stop DPS that the NieR team has when compared Rank for Rank. In a drawn-out fight, NieR wins out. When it comes to extremely fast and high damage, the other Physical team wins.
It is important to emphasize that different teams have different strengths.
Regardless of which way opinions swing on this matter, it is a fact that having more characters is better in PGR. There are many gameplay modes where having multiple teams is important, and you will often find yourself wishing you had even more characters. You will likely find yourself using both the standard Physical team as well as the NieR team.

2B was censored in the CN version — will she be censored in Global?
While 2B's underwear was changed to be less risqué in CN, it was not censored in the JP version. Global has historically followed suit with the JP version's coatings, so there is no reason to believe that 2B's default outfit will be censored in Global.
Please note that 2B's alternate coating, Revealing Outfit, is slightly different in PGR compared to its appearance in NieR: Automata. In both its CN and JP releases, parts of the outfit are torn and damaged, while other parts have more coverage (specifically around the bust and back of the underwear). Because this design direction was used for both the CN and JP releases, it's expected that this coating will remain this way for the Global release as well.
